Marion George Rogers
PVT/US ARMY: Student Army Training Corps
Birth: September 24, 1898 in Lewis County, WV
Death: February 7, 1953 in District Heights, MD

ADDITIONAL FACTS OF NOTE
Military Information
Age at Enlistment:                       17 years and 11 months
Home Residence during War:    Lewis County, WV
Military Years:                               1917-1919
                          Induction 10/2/1918, Private,
                          Student Army Training Corps
                          WV Wesleyan College (Buckhannon, WV)              

                          Honorable Discharge 12/21/1918
Decorations:                              

Personal Information
Occupation:      Educator/Teacher (Elm Street School)
Father:              George M. Rogers
Mother:             Mattie Miller
Spouse:             Virginia Davies
​
Last known residence:   7817 Atwood, District Heights, MD
Cause of Death:    Heart attack
